Biometrics As A Service Market Overview

**Segments**

- **By Modality:** The market is segmented into fingerprint recognition, facial recognition, iris recognition, voice recognition, and others. The fingerprint recognition segment is expected to dominate the market during the forecast period due to its widespread adoption and ease of use.
- **By Deployment Model:** Biometrics as a service can be deployed on-premises or on the cloud. The cloud-based deployment model is anticipated to witness significant growth as more organizations opt for cloud services for cost-efficiency and scalability.
- **By Organization Size:**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) as well as large enterprises are the key segments in this market. SMEs are increasingly adopting biometrics as a service solutions to enhance their security measures and ensure regulatory compliance.
- **By Vertical:** The market caters to various industry verticals such as BFSI, healthcare, IT and telecommunications, government and defense, retail, and others. The BFSI sector is projected to hold a substantial market share owing to the rising need for secure authentication processes.

**Market Players**

- **NEC Corporation:** NEC Corporation offers a wide range of biometric solutions as a service, including fingerprint recognition and facial recognition technologies. The company's innovative offerings have garnered significant traction in the market.
- **Fujitsu Limited:** Fujitsu Limited is a prominent player in the biometrics as a service market, providing iris recognition and palm vein authentication solutions. The company's emphasis on research and development ensures cutting-edge biometric technologies.
- **BioID:** BioID specializes in biometric authentication solutions, offering a cloud-based biometrics as a service platform. Their focus on robust security and user convenience sets them apart in the industry.
- **M2SYS Technology:** M2SYS Technology is known for its biometric identity management solutions, catering to various sectors globally. The company's scalable offerings make them a preferred choice for organizations seeking reliable biometric services.
- **IDEMIA:** IDEMIA offers advanced biometric solutions tailored for government, enterprises, and individuals. Their comprehensive suite of biometrics as a service products positions them as a key player in the market.

Biometrics as a service is a rapidly evolving market with a promising future ahead. Beyond the segmentation outlined in the provided content, there are emerging trends and factors shaping the landscape of this industry. One notable trend is the increasing integration of biometric solutions with art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ning algorithms. This integration enables more robust and intelligent authentication processes, enhancing security measures and user experience. As AI continues to advance, biometric systems are expected to become more sophisticated and adaptable, further driving market growth.

Moreover, the growing emphasis on data privacy and regulatory compliance is influencing the adoption of biometrics as a service. Organizations are increasingly prioritizing solutions that not only offer secure authentication but also adhere to stringent data protection regulations such as GDPR and CCPA. Biometric service providers that can demonstrate compliance with these regulations are likely to gain a competitive edge in the market.

Another significant factor impacting the market is the rising demand for contactless authentication solutions. The global shift towards contactless technologies, accelerated by the COVID-19 pandemic, has fueled the adoption of biometric systems that require minimal physical interaction. This trend is particularly prevalent in industries such as healthcare, retail, and hospitality, where maintaining hygiene and safety standards is paramount.

Furthermore, the evolution of biometric as a service offerings to include multimodal biometrics is gaining traction in the market. By combining multiple biometric modalities such as fingerprint, facial, and iris recognition, providers can offer enhanced security and accuracy in identity verification processes. Multimodal biometric systems are becoming increasingly popular in high-security applications such as border control, law enforcement, and critical infrastructure protection.

In terms of market dynamics, the competitive landscape of the biometrics as a service market is characterized by intense rivalry among key players. Companies are focusing on strategic partnerships, product innovations, and geographic expansion to gain a larger market share. Additionally, the market is witnessing a surge in mergers and acquisitions as players look to enhance their capabilities and offerings to meet the evolving needs of customers.

Looking ahead, the biometrics as a service market is poised for robust growth driven by technological advancements, increasing cybersecurity concerns, and the growing adoption of digital transformation initiatives across industries.
